China Armco Metals, Inc. to Present at the Rodman & Renshaw Annual Global Investment Conference in New York City on November 10, 2008 at 11:35 a.m. EST
San Mateo, California, October 23, 2008 (PRIME NEWSWIRE) – China Armco Metals, Inc., (OTCBB: CNAM - News) (“ARMCO” or “the Company”), a leading metal ore distributor and metal recycler in China, today announced that the Company will present at the Rodman & Renshaw Annual Global Investment Conference on Monday, November 10th, 2008. The Conference will be held November 10th-12th at the New York Palace Hotel located in New York City.
The Company’s presentation will take place in Henry Salon (5th Floor) at 11:35 a.m. EST and management will participate in one-on-one meetings with analysts and investors throughout the three-day event. Mr. Kexuan Yao, Chairman and CEO and Mr. Gary Liu, Investor Relations Coordinator will present on behalf of the Company.
Management will discuss the Company’s performance to date, its current business segments, customer base and sales channel throughout China and detail its growth plans in the foreseeable future.

About China Armco Metals, Inc.
China Armco Metals, Inc. is engaged in the sale and distribution of metal ores and non-ferrous metals throughout the PRC and the recycling of scrap metal for the Chinese market. The Company maintains customers throughout China which include the fastest growing steel producing mills and foundries in the PRC. Raw materials are supplied from global suppliers in India, Hong Kong, Nigeria, Brazil, Turkey, the Philippines and Libya. The Company’s product lines include ferrous and non-ferrous ore; iron ore, chrome ore, nickel ore, copper ore, magnese ore and steel billet. Beginning in the second quarter 2009, Armco expects to begin operations in its steel recycling and scrap metal supply. The recycling facility is expected to be capable of recycling one million metric tons of scrap metal per year which will position the Company as one of the top 10 largest recyclers of scrap metal in China. ARMCO estimates the recycled metal market as 70 million metric tons.
